Job description

Core Requirements of the Post
  • Be committed to developing their knowledge of curriculum and pedagogy;
  • Support a safe and positive learning environment through mutual respect, contributing to a collective sense of belonging;
  • Demonstrates a secure knowledge and understanding of how students develop and learn, physically, socially, emotionally, and intellectually;
  • Inspire trust and confidence in students, colleagues and parents;
  • Understand inclusive learning and can personalise instruction and support to meet the needs of each student;
  • Have high expectations of students, appropriately challenging and inspiring them in their learning;
  • Demonstrate effective use of assessment to inform and support student learning;
  • Contribute to an environment where students understand themselves as learners, what they are learning and why, engaging in meaningful reflection and feedback;
  • Be committed to high achievement for a diverse student body;
  • Actively and enthusiastically contribute in the wider context of the school community;
  • Promote the school mission and values and those of the NAE family of schools;
  • Engage in ongoing professional learning, applying up to date and evidence informed approaches to teaching practice
Areas of Responsibility and Key Tasks
Engagement and Interaction - School Ambassador to Internal Community
  • Has an awareness of school Safeguarding policy and understands reporting procedure.
  • Follow all the guidance laid out in our Code of Conduct, Child Safeguarding Policy and related policies.
  • Awareness of possible dangers and immediately act appropriately on them.
  • Carefully observe students and actively participate during break duties.
  • Able to follow guidelines during emergency procedures.
  • Maintain confidentiality within school.
Learning and Teaching
  • Support teaching and learning inside and outside the classroom.
  • Assist class teacher in assessment and record keeping as directed.
  • Be involved with school trips and extra-curricular activities.
  • Foster positive relationships with parents and the wider community.
  • Work with small groups, extending their learning based on individual targets and formative assessment as directed by teacher.
Planning and Preparation
  • Undertake routine tasks as required
  • Supervisory duties as required.
  • Assist in the display of pupils' work and production/maintenance of resources (as directed by class teacher).
  • Assist teachers with preparation of class materials to support the individual needs of specific learners
  • Ensure the teachers have all the resources required for teaching
